Definitions and Meaning of mandible in English
mandible (n)
the jaw in vertebrates that is hinged to open the mouth
mandible (n.)
The bone, or principal bone, of the lower jaw; the inferior maxilla; -- also applied to either the upper or the lower jaw in the beak of birds.
The anterior pair of mouth organs of insects, crustaceaus, and related animals, whether adapted for biting or not. See Illust. of Diptera.
